Original Description
Johan Severin Nilsson’s Landskap Med Insjovik (Landscape with Lake Bay) is a luminous example of Scandinavian Romanticism, capturing the serene beauty of Sweden’s natural landscapes with poetic sensitivity. Painted in the late 19th century, Nilsson’s work reflects his mastery of light and atmosphere, blending meticulous detail with a soft, almost dreamlike quality. The scene likely depicts a tranquil lakeside vista, where the interplay of water, sky, and foliage evokes a sense of timeless harmony—a hallmark of Nordic Romanticism’s reverence for nature. While Nilsson may not be as internationally renowned as his contemporaries like Carl Larsson, his contributions to Swedish landscape painting remain significant, offering a quieter but equally evocative counterpart to the era’s grander narratives. The painting’s subdued palette and balanced composition align with the period’s emphasis on emotional resonance over dramatic flourish, making it a subtle yet enduring piece in art history.
